    Fork
    /fôrk/

    noun

    • 1. an implement with two or more prongs used for lifting food to the mouth or holding it when cutting.
    • 2. the point where something, especially a road or river, divides into two parts: "turn right at the next fork"

    verb

    • 1. (especially of a road or other route) divide into two parts: "the place where the road forks"
    • 2. dig, lift, or manipulate (something) with a fork: "fork in some compost"

  6. An eating utensil with several points or prongs is called a fork. If you aren't skilled at using chopsticks, you can ask the waiter at the Chinese restaurant to bring you a fork. In most Western households, forks are a basic part of a table setting — unless all you're eating is soup.

  7. A fork is a utensil with two or more prongs, used for eating or serving food, or a tool with two or more prongs, used for lifting, digging, etc. A fork can also refer to a bifurcation or separation into two or more branches or parts, or a point or part at which such a bifurcation occurs.
